ASA Nominees Pty Ltd v Owners Corporation PS 513436B and Adamopoulos [2016] VSC 562 arose from a surveyors error which occurred when lots in the plan of subdivision were re-subdivided. An amended plan was registered which showed the boundary between two lots as located 3 metres to the west of the wall that was intended to form the boundary. Continue reading
